ARC MOVEMENT

ARC movement can be illustrated by the simplified image on left:
• During a lift, the lifting points shift from A to A’.
• The movement also creates a change in the angle (ARC).
• This angle needs the right kind of lifting material, else it will be unable to support the wing.
